New Review: The first time I saw this movie, I enjoyed it and gave it an appropriately positive review but now, more than five years later, I keep revisiting "The Mist" as one of the most effective horror movies of the 21st century and one of the most well-made post-9/11 allegories you could hope to ask for.
Marcia Gay Harden makes my skin crawl every time and the movie has an additional dose of awesome in that it stars like half of the "Walking Dead" cast. The monsters are effectively Lovecraftian and the ending is one of the craziest I've ever seen.
This is like the gold standard for me when it comes to adaptations of King's horror works.
